How far is Casper from Hibbing?

The distance from Casper to Hibbing is 722.7 miles (1163 km) as the crow flies. Hibbing is located ENE of Casper. By car, the driving distance is approximately 867.2 miles, taking about 17h 27min. A direct flight would take roughly 1h 57min. Both are located in United States — Casper in Wyoming and Hibbing in Minnesota.
